Reinstituted 1 September 1939. (1939 1945 issue). Constructed of iron and silver, consisting of a Cross Patte with a blackened magnetic iron core within a ribbed silver frame, the obverse with a central mobile swastika, the six oclock arm with a reinstitution date of 1939, the reverse with a screwback attachment with backplate, marked with LDO code L 13 for maker Paul Meybauer, Berlin, measuring 44. 44 mm (w)
